Power Gig: Rise of the Sixstring. - Guitar Hero replacement

Seven45 has decided to release a more realistic instrumental game. Power Gig is a lot like guitar hero and rock band except you are playing with an actual guitar. This might teach people to play basic guitar, but unfortunately it won't teach you how to read real music sheets.

On the easiest difficulty setting the game doesn't call on gamers to switch strings -- it will register a correct note as long as the coloured fret matches up with the strum -- but on harder difficulties a coloured note in a song will display a number relating to a particular string.

The interface in Rise of the Six String looks similar to Rock Band, sending notes streaming downward with coloured cues relating to the frets on the guitar.

When not plugged into an Xbox 360, the Power Gig controller will actually work with standard guitar amps and strum like you'd expect. Will this shoot the controller prices sky high?

Power Gig - Rise of the Six String is currently slated for a Fall 2010 release, but the game is still in its early stages and information such as price and the release date are still forthcoming.

Farmville bigger than WOW


A while back I played farmville on facebook, stopped because it took me over an hour per session, just clicking, and now I'm being spammed by requests. It seems like everyone is playing this time consuming game. Apparently this is not so far from the truth.

As you can see from the Facebook statistics below FarmVille is the number 1 application of the number 1 developer within Facebook with a enormous 81,125,786 daily users. Currently facebook has more than 400 million active users as can be seen on Facebook's statistics page. According to my calculations that means a fifth of facebook users are playing Farmville!!



Below is a display of Farmville's user statistics for the last month. When comparing these stats with mmorp's World of Warcraft one of the biggest online games, FarmVille not only beats it but the user community is at least 7 times as big!!

Browser Game: Urban Rivals

I like playing new games, keeps the Internet interesting :) If you like card games like magic then you will really love this game. It is simple and easy to begin and a lot of fun :) Urban Rivals lets you register quite easily and let you play in challenging level based arena's. Here is how it works. You get to play with 5 cards from your deck. Each card contains a damage and power rating. Each rating can be boosted with pills. The dynamics of the game comes in when you play against a skilled player and need to use your pills to your advantage to destroy the other players health while keeping your health in tack. Zero Punctuation game reviews

Zero Punctuation is a video game review series created by comedy writer, video game journalist and gamer Ben “Yahtzee” Croshaw and produced by online magazine The Escapist.

In his videos Croshaw usually reviews a recent game or games using rapid-fire speech delivery (which was the inspiration for the name 'Zero Punctuation', although he states that his fast talking was “by accident”). This is accompanied by minimalistic cartoon imagery on a distinctive yellow background, illustrating what is being said. The videos are typically around five minutes in length. The end credits often feature humorous notes about Croshaw's reviews such as 'Systematically alienating every type of fanboy' in GTA IV, and often also contain characters from the review engaging in slapstick.
